The article 《Inhibition of fructolytic enzymes in boar spermatozoa by (S)-α-chlorohydrin and 1-chloro-3-hydroxypropanone》 in relation to this compound, is published in Australian Journal of Biological Sciences. When boar spermatozoa were incubated with (S)-α-chlorohydrin [60827-45-4], glyceraldehyde-3-phosphate dehydrogenase (GPD) [9001-50-7] activity was inhibited. The (R)-isomer had no effect whereas (R,S)-3-chlorolactaldehyde [84709-24-0] also inhibited GDP and lactate dehydrogenase [9001-60-9]. The in vitro production of (S)-3-chlorolactaldehyde [86747-03-7], the active metabolite of (S)-α-chlorohydrin, was attempted by incubating boar spermatozoa with 1-chloro-3-hydroxypropanone [24423-98-1]. Preliminary results indicated that this compound is converted into (S)-3-chlorolactaldehyde as well as to another metabolite which is an inhibitor of other enzymes within the fructolytic pathway.
